COOPER, Judge.

This action was originally brought by the Cofrancesco Construction Company, Inc. and the Trustees of Phillips Temple C.M.E. Church in an effort to enjoin Superior Components, Inc. from enforcing a mechanic's lien for materials used in construction of a church, and to recover actual and punitive damages for the erroneous filing of said lien.
